How do I keep the "Same as Previous" option off on the Header tool
Unfortunately, "Same as Previous" is turned on by default as you
create a new section.
Also note that each section can have up to three different headers
(and footers); it does if you enabled "Different first page" and
"Different odd and even" on the Layout tab of FilePage Setup. You'll
have to turn "Same as Previous" off for each type of header, as well
as for each type of footer. (If you always limit a section to a page,
I guess you shouldn't be [directly] affected by this.)
